Si cellule contient un texte d'une liste alors copier coller des autres cellules

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Globus

XLDnaute Nouveau
Bonjour à toutes et à tous,

J'ai un "petit" souci avec mon fichier et je ne sais même pas comment m'y prendre pour vous dire.

Je vous explique:
Dans l'onglet "PARIS", j'aimerais mettre une formule (colonne I) qui va identifier le nom d'une personne que je mettrai en colonne D.
Si dans cette dernière colonne, la formule trouve le nom de la liste dans l'onglet "CHAUFFEUR", alors elle recopiera l'immatriculation, le prénom du dispatcheur et la filiale de cette liste et la mettra en colonne E, F et G dans l'onglet "PARIS".

Si vous avez des idées/ suggestion/solutions, je suis partant et je vous remercie par avance!


Ci-joint, les 3 images qui pourront expliquer mieux mon idée:


L'onglet Paris, avant de mettre la formule dans la cellule I:
1581341283694.png




L'onglet CHAUFFEUR:
1581341858970.png




Le résultat souhaité avec la formule:
1581341662252.png
 
un grand merci JHA! ça m'aide énormément 🙂

Petite question de ma part : si jamais je dois modifier / ajouter des chauffeurs dans l'onglet CHAUFFEUR, je dois faire quoi pour que la colonne D dans l'onglet PARIS prenne en compte ce changement? Modifier la liste déroulante dans l'onglet chauffeur?

merci d'avance!
 
Bonjour à tous,

J'ai modifié les 2 plages nommées ("Nom" et "Chauffeurs") pour les rendre dynamiques.
Si tu ajoutes des noms de chauffeurs, ils seront pris en compte dans la liste déroulante et dans les formules.
plage chauffeurs
VB:
=DECALER(chauffeur!$A$2;;;NBVAL(chauffeur!$A:$A)-1;10)
plage Nom
Code:
=DECALER(chauffeur!$A$2;;;NBVAL(chauffeur!$A:$A)-1)
voir onglet ruban Formules/gestionnaire de noms

JHA
 

Pièces jointes

Bonjour à tous,

J'ai modifié les 2 plages nommées ("Nom" et "Chauffeurs") pour les rendre dynamiques.
Si tu ajoutes des noms de chauffeurs, ils seront pris en compte dans la liste déroulante et dans les formules.
plage chauffeurs
VB:
=DECALER(chauffeur!$A$2;;;NBVAL(chauffeur!$A:$A)-1;10)
plage Nom
Code:
=DECALER(chauffeur!$A$2;;;NBVAL(chauffeur!$A:$A)-1)
voir onglet ruban Formules/gestionnaire de noms

JHA

Merci JHA, ça fonctionne très bien! 🙂
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
6
Affichages
855
Retour